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How soon should I contact a Fort Lauderdale car accident injury lawyer after my accident?
A: It's crucial to contact a Fort Lauderdale car accident injury lawyer as soon as possible after your accident. Florida has a four-year statute of limitations for personal injury claims. Prompt action helps preserve evidence, interview witnesses while memories are fresh, and begin building your case effectively for your Fort Lauderdale injury claim.
Q: What types of compensation can I seek with a Fort Lauderdale car accident injury claim?
A: Fort Lauderdale car accident injury victims may be entitled to compensation for various damages, including medical expenses (past and future), lost wages (past and future), pain and suffering, emotional distress, and property damage. A Fort Lauderdale lawyer can evaluate your specific situation and pursue all potential compensation avenues.
Q: Do I have to pay legal fees if my Fort Lauderdale car accident case doesn't settle?
A: Most Fort Lauderdale car accident injury lawyers work on a contingency fee basis. This means you only pay attorney's fees if they successfully settle or win your case. Our Fort Lauderdale office understands the financial burden of an accident and structures fees accordingly.
